I reread this series this month, and it was a lot of fun to revisit. I read this series as a teen and loved it then, and I'm happy that it still (mostly) holds up for me now. Some of it may just be due to nostalgia, and there are some aspects of the series that haven't aged well, but overall I still enjoyed it very much. It's still surprisingly pretty funny too. Some of the humor is of a more slapstick, cartoon-y type, but I think that works in a series like this, especially considering the outlandish stuff Hikari and Takishima are able to do.

Speaking of which, Hikari and Takishima have such a fun rivals-to-lovers storyline, and that's the strongest part of the series for me. I love how much Takishima clearly admires Hikari and always stands up for her when other people try to put her down for always being in second place. And I also love that Hikari stands up for herself too and gives as good as she gets when Takishima teases her, and how she believes so strongly in rising to a challenge and working hard and giving a task her all, no matter the outcome. They're such a great power couple when they get together.

I also like that even though Hikari and Takishima are the main characters, the other characters in the class and outside the class get their own storylines and chapters to follow their perspective too. Everyone gets a chance to shine and grow, and that makes the series even better.

So yeah, 4 stars from me. Nostalgia wants me to give 5, but there are a few things that I wish were written differently, so 4 stars feels right for me.
